我错误地做了一个小的分区分区在我的Debian安装,并在这个裸机服务器上安装openvz后 ,我注意到,我创build了这个分区的生产VPS ,并达到100%
这是df -h结果:
Sys. fich. Taille Util. Dispo Uti% Monté sur udev 10M 0 10M 0% /dev tmpfs 3,2G 352K 3,2G 1% /run /dev/md2 20G 18G 179M 100% / tmpfs 5,0M 0 5,0M 0% /run/lock tmpfs 6,5G 0 6,5G 0% /dev/shm /dev/md3 1,8T 4,3G 1,7T 1% /home /dev/ploop22956p1 25G 4,5G 20G 19% /var/lib/vz/root/1 /dev/ploop30467p1 25G 3,7G 20G 16% /var/lib/vz/root/2 /dev/ploop61065p1 25G 1,7G 22G 8% /var/lib/vz/root/4 /dev/ploop44786p1 25G 1,5G 22G 7% /var/lib/vz/root/5 /dev/ploop27624p1 25G 2,3G 22G 10% /var/lib/vz/root/3 /dev/ploop45115p1 25G 639M 23G 3% /var/lib/vz/root/6
我知道gnu parted可以使用resize命令来做到这一点,但我从来没有使用过它,我不想冒这个风险,无论如何要做到这一点,而不会丢失数据?
是的你可以,但不要依赖它(即先备份你的数据!)。
分区应该是相邻的,为了方便起见,您希望将其扩展到您想要扩展的分区之后的分区。
然后,只需使用parted在设备上,删除两个分区(如sdb1 , sdb2 ),创build一个跨越整个空间的新的,并使用resize2fs增长文件系统,使它使用所有可用的空间。
我最近用一些家庭数据做了这个 – 我不会build议用你唯一的重要数据副本来做。
你可以做,但要小心。
使用resize2fs来调整分区的大小,然后你可以调整分区来匹配使用cfdisk。 如果不指定最终的大小, resize2fs将会变得更加合适,而增长分区总是比缩小它容易。